Andre and Noah started tracking their savings at the same time. Andre started with $15 and deposits $5 per week. Noah started with $2.50 and deposits $7.50 per week. The graph of Noah's savings is given and his equation is y = 7.5x + 2.5, where * represents the number of weeks and y represents his savings. Write the equation for Andre's savings and graph it alongside Noah's. What does the intersection point mean in this situation?
